The lining on the belly is called the peritoneum. It is a membrane that lines the abdominal cavity and covers the organs within the abdomen.

What are the Belly and loins of a horse called?

The belly area of a horse is called the barrel, while the loins are referred to as the coupling.


What is the tissue lining the uterus called?

The lining of the uterine cavity is called the "endometrium". It consists of the functional endometrium and the basal endometrium from which the former arises

What is the belly of a horse called?

A horses belly can be called a belly or stomach typically. If you are looking at the horse from the side and are assessing the horses conformation the entire mid-piece of the horse, stomach included, is called the barrel.
